Up, Up and Away!: Tilted Kilt, Milford 1st To Deliver Wings By Drone
Sorry, no buff guy in a cool red cape. But one better. Beautiful women in red kilts. And some seriously awesome wings. How’s that for a lead in….
Although the delivery actually happened on June 17th, the whole idea started long before then. A while back, a certain Internet Mega business that shall remain nameless (Starts with an “A” and ends with a “zon”) said that they were considering deliveries by drone. And, we are still waiting for that one. But Sara Vause, General Manager of The Tilted Kilt in Milford wasn’t about to wait for someone else to do it. Now enter Mr. Outrageous Marketing himself. Kyle Reyes of The Silent Partner Marketing, Manchester, and Joe Papa of MultiRotor Pilot Magazine. Their task was to pull this delivery off.
So, here is that task. Take a TWO POUND order of wings, and Go-Pro camera, and attach it to a quad-copter. Sounds easy right? Wrong. First off, the load has to have the weight properly distributed, and secured. Throw in wind, possible shifting of weight and distance. Not so easy after all.
